Find the simple interest earned by each account. $1,200 principal at 5.5% interest for 25 years

Answer:

The simple interest is $1650

Step-by-step explanation:

Simple Interest = PRT/100

where p = principal, r = rate and t = time

p = $1200, r = 5.5%, and t = 25 years

SI = (1200*5.5*25)/100

SI = 12*5.5*25

SI = $1650
